Ekiti State Governor, Kayode Fayemi , has debunked rumor that suggests he has dropped his presidential ambition for Vice President , Yemi Osinbajo.
NAIJA NEWS NG reports that Fayemi cleared the air via a statement released by his media aide, Femi Ige.
Fayemi described the claim as “absolute rubbish”, adding that real leaders of the All Progressives Congress are backing his ambition.

The statement read;
“[It is] absolute rubbish. No meeting took place between us and any aspirant about stepping down.
“We are undoubtedly among the leading aspirants for the position and one to watch in the race.
“Our candidate has deep trust and respect among political leaders in the party and also from fellow governors who form a critical mass in the decision-making process.”
